Rich ,
I too had considered doing the toyota conversion and i spoke with Pete and he said that some of the parts from my BN7 (and most likely that would include your BT7) WERE NOT COMPATABLE WITH THE SWAP. I think he did say to use a BJ8 fly wheel and pressure plate and I agree with others that it would be best to have the assembly lightened up. What I ended up doing was rebuilding my orginal side shift and it really wasn't very difficult to work on and I only spent around $ 350.00. I replaced one shift fork, the second gear syncronizer, the lay shaft bearings,detent balls and springs, all the gaskets. Make sure to use thread sealer on the bolts that enter through the case to oil. Shifts great now.
